Why Are Companies Pursuing Large-Scale Mergers?
Several core drivers underpin the surge in mega-mergers. These include:
- Market Share Expansion: Consolidation allows firms to reduce competition and secure a larger customer base.
- Synergy Realisation: Combining assets, R&D capabilities, and operational efficiencies create cost savings and revenue growth.
- Innovation Acceleration: Pooling technological expertise fosters faster development of new products and services.
- Global Presence: Mergers enable rapid entry into new geographical markets, especially within emerging economies.
Challenges and Risks of Corporate Mergers
However, the path to successful mergers is fraught with obstacles:
- Cultural Integration: Differing corporate cultures can impair collaboration and operational synergy.
- Regulatory Scrutiny: Antitrust authorities increasingly scrutinise large deals, leading to delays or cancellations.
- Operational Disruptions: Integration complexities can temporarily impair service delivery and stakeholder confidence.
- Shareholder Value: Not all mergers deliver expected financial benefits, risking shareholder dissatisfaction.
Emerging Trends Shaping the Future of M&As
As the landscape evolves, new patterns are emerging:
- Digital Transformation as a Catalyst: Tech-driven mergers are catalysing industries to adopt AI, blockchain, and cloud solutions rapidly.
- Sustainability and ESG Alignment: Companies increasingly seek mergers that reinforce environmental, social, and governance (ESG) commitments.
- Private Equity’s Role: Private equity firms are orchestrating complex mergers to optimise assets before IPOs or further sale.
- Cross-Industry Mergers: Diversification in product and service lines creates resilience and new revenue streams.
